How Does DirectStorage Work?

DirectStorage is part of the latest DirectX API or software Programming Interface.

This is a set of standard software functions that handles communication between software and hardware.

This is why game developers no longer have to develop their games for specific graphics or sound cards.

As long as the hardware and software comply with DirectX, it should all just work.

DirectStorage handles the loading of files from high-speed SSDs.

It accelerates the speed at which data can be read from these drives in several ways.

For example, it allows for data files to be requested and loaded in parallel.

But perhaps most importantly, it allows for hardware decompression.

This increases the effective read speed of the drive beyond its actual maximum speed.

The version of DirectStorage shipping with Forspoken isDirectStorage 1.1.

Although version 1.0 has been available for some time, no game developers have yet taken advantage of it.

This is likely because 1.0 lacked the asset decompression feature that makes 1.1 so compelling.
